Holden Torana 4-door Race Car 1977

The Holden Torana 4-door Race Car (1977) is a legendary piece of Australian motorsport history, particularly in its racing-spec A9X and SL/R 5000 variants. Built for competitive touring car championships like Bathurst, the 4-door version combined muscle car performance with the practicality of a sedan. Its aggressive stance, flared wheel arches, deep front spoiler, and rear ducktail spoiler defined its track-focused silhouette.
Under the hood, it typically featured a powerful 5.0-liter V8 engine tuned for racing, paired with performance enhancements such as heavy-duty suspension, racing wheels, a roll cage, and weight-reducing measures. The car often wore iconic liveries, sponsor decals, and bold racing numbers, making it instantly recognizable on the circuit. Its lightweight chassis and raw power made it a dominant force during the late 1970s in Australian touring car racing.
